Kijipwa Airport is a Kenyan “Bush” airport located on the grounds of Bamburi Cement in the Mombasa area. Our history is deeply rooted in East African Aviation. Previously owned and operated by one of Kenya’s aviation pioneers, Alan Herd, as a retirement hobby, Kijipwa enjoys the same understanding of the operating environment that made Alan and Kijipwa so well known. Kijipwa aviation is now expanding its original vision and services to the entire East African region. Situated in the beautiful Northern outskirts of the Mombasa area, Kijipwa Aviation provides Aviation services in Aviation Maintenance, Air Bridge, Data Acquisitions and Processing and Specialized Charters.
